Portland Trust, a developer of commercial structures with its headquarters in Prague, bought a plot from Nusco Group with the area of 4 ha in the northern and central part of Bucharest. It is going to build on it a modern and energy-saving office.

The project is a response to increasing need for technologically advanced and at the same time eco-friendly office spaces in this part of Europe. This is our 5th office development in Bucharest. Following the recent success of Floreasca Park, we intend to capitalize on those aspects such as the energy saving technology in the hope of attracting cost and energy conscious tenants – says Robert Neale, Managing Director of Portland Trust.

 

Partnerships were advised by The Adviser and Knight Frank companies and the legal aid was given by McCann & Associates office.

 

Portland Trust has an experience in realization of high standard investments on the local office markets. In portfolio of the company, there are nearly 120 000 sq. m of offices, located in such complexes as: Opera Center (built in two stages: in 2001 and 2002), Bucharest Business Park (2006), Floreasca 169A (2009) and Floreasca Park (2013). The last one, with the area of 37 500 sq. m, received BREEAM certification. Among its tenants are i.a. Oracle, Allianz and Kellogg’s.
